Description
This is a barn located approximately 50 metres west of Shiplake Rise Farmhouse, dating from the early 18th century. It has a flint base with brick dressings, a timber frame, and is covered with weatherboarding and a plain tile roof. The barn features five bays, with central plank double doors and a hipped midstrey on the west side. Inside, there are jowled wall posts and a curved principal roof construction.
